Brief summary
The aim of this study is to test whether the attention-enhancing effects of low-dose nicotine can be enhanced by the drug galantamine, FDA-approved for the treatment of Alzheimer's disease. This proof-of-principle study is performed in healthy non-smokers and involves two single exposures to a nicotine patch (7 mg/24 hrs) and two single exposures to galantamine (4 mg). The dose of galantamine is substantially lower than the clinical dose range of 16-24 mg/day. The hypothesis is that performance-enhancing effects of nicotine are greater in the presence of this low dose of galantamine.
Detailed description
Healthy non-smokers will be screened for study eligibility and receive training on three different attention tasks. Over four test session, participants will then perform these tasks after receiving (1) a placebo patch and a placebo capsule, (2) a nicotine patch (7 mg/24 hrs) and a placebo capsule, (3) a placebo patch and a galantamine capsule, and (4) a nicotine patch and a galantamine capsule. The four test session are performed on separate days and take approximately 7 hours each. During the first 5 hours, the participant may read or watch TV while nicotine and/or galantamine are being absorbed. During the last two hours, the participant will perform the attention tasks on a computer. The investigators hypothesize that performance-enhancing effects of nicotine, which were documented in previous research, will be larger in the presence than in the absence of galantamine. This proof-of-concept would have implications for the development of drugs for the treatment of conditions such as Alzheimer's disease or schizophrenia.

Eligibility
Inclusion criteria
* Aged 21 to 55 years. * No exposure to any nicotine-containing product in the last year. * Smoked no more that 40 cigarettes, cigars or cigarillos in lifetime. * Normal or corrected to normal vision (at least 20/80). * Body weight 110-220 lbs.
Exclusion criteria
* Pregnant or breast-feeding. * Drug or alcohol abuse or dependence currently or in the last 2 years. * DSM Axis I mood, anxiety or psychotic disorder. * Cardiovascular or cerebrovascular disease, such as history of myocardial infarction and ischemia, heart failure, angina, stroke, severe arrhythmias, or EKG abnormalities (Wolf-Parkinson-White syndrome, Complete left bundle branch block, PR interval \<120 ms or \>200 ms, Prolonged QT interval (corrected) \>500 ms, Cardiac arrhythmias as defined by PACs \>3 per min or PVCs \>1 per min). * Uncontrolled hypertension (resting systolic BP above 140 or diastolic above 90 mm Hg). * Hypotension (resting systolic BP below 90 or diastolic below 60). * Significant kidney or liver impairment. * Moderate to severe asthma. * Obstructive pulmonary disease. * Type I or II diabetes. * Use of any centrally active medications; any peripherally acting cholinergic medications; cimetidine; ketoconazole; erythromycin; quinidine, or chronic nonsteroidal anti-inflammatory drugs. * History of or current neurological illnesses, such as stroke, seizure disorders, neurodegenerative diseases, or organic brain syndrome. * Learning disability, mental retardation, or any other condition that impedes cognition. * Heart rate \<55 bpm. * Current or history of gastric ulcer disease. * Any surgeries requiring full anesthesia scheduled within 2 weeks of any of the study test sessions. * Anemia. * Inability to perform the Rapid Visual Information Processing Task.

Outcome results
Change Detection Task Accuracy
The task requires encoding the color of 1 or 5 shape items and reporting whether or not one of the items changed color. Accuracy refers to the percentage of all trials in which a correct response was given. One participant's data were excluded from this task because of excessive no-response trials.
Time frame: 15 min
Population: Healthy adult non-smokers
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Placebo Patch and Placebo Capsule | Change Detection Task Accuracy | 83 percentage of all trials | Standard Deviation 6 |
| Nicotine Patch and Placebo Capsule | Change Detection Task Accuracy | 83 percentage of all trials | Standard Deviation 6 |
| Placebo Patch and Galantamine Capsule | Change Detection Task Accuracy | 84 percentage of all trials | Standard Deviation 6 |
| Nicotine Patch and Galantamine Capsule | Change Detection Task Accuracy | 84 percentage of all trials | Standard Deviation 6 |

Rapid Visual Information Processing Task Hit Rate
The task requires following a stream of digits and detecting three consecutive odd or even numbers. The Hit Rate reflects the percentage of all target sequences that were detected.
Time frame: 30 min
Population: Healthy adult non-smokers
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Placebo Patch and Placebo Capsule | Rapid Visual Information Processing Task Hit Rate | 50 percentage of all targets | Standard Deviation 19 |
| Nicotine Patch and Placebo Capsule | Rapid Visual Information Processing Task Hit Rate | 54 percentage of all targets | Standard Deviation 18 |
| Placebo Patch and Galantamine Capsule | Rapid Visual Information Processing Task Hit Rate | 49 percentage of all targets | Standard Deviation 21 |
| Nicotine Patch and Galantamine Capsule | Rapid Visual Information Processing Task Hit Rate | 54 percentage of all targets | Standard Deviation 19 |
